Codeberg Overview
-
Mission-Driven Collaboration Platform: Codeberg is a non-profit, community-driven collaboration platform for free and open-source software (FOSS) development. It emphasizes ethical technology and privacy.
-
Based on Gitea: It s built upon Gitea, a self-hosted Git service written in Go. This provides a robust, lightweight, and feature-rich alternative to platforms like GitHub and GitLab.
-
Focus on Ethical Technology: Codeberg champions software freedom, data privacy, and transparency. It operates as a registered non-profit organization (Codeberg e.V.) in Germany.
-
Key Features:
- Git repository hosting (public and private).
- Issue tracking.
- Pull requests (merge requests).
- Wiki.
- Project boards (Kanban-style).
- Code review.
- Built-in CI/CD (basic).
- Organization support.
- SSH and HTTPS access.
- Webhooks.
-
Target Audience: Developers and organizations committed to FOSS, privacy, and ethical technology. Individuals who want a platform that aligns with open-source values.
Revenue
-
No Direct Revenue Streams: Codeberg operates as a non-profit and does not generate revenue through traditional means like subscriptions or advertising.
-
Donation-Based Funding: Its primary funding comes from donations and sponsorships. They rely on the community to support its operations.
-
Transparency: Codeberg is transparent about its finances. They publish information about their income and expenses.
Alternatives
Here s a breakdown of Codeberg alternatives, catering to various needs:
-
GitHub:
- Pros: Massive community, extensive integrations, mature features, widely used, excellent documentation, GitHub Actions (powerful CI/CD).
- Cons: Owned by Microsoft (potential privacy concerns for some), less focused on extreme privacy, can be expensive for larger private repositories on paid plans.
- Best For: General-purpose development, large teams, projects requiring extensive integrations and a vast ecosystem.
-
GitLab:
- Pros: Comprehensive DevOps platform (CI/CD, monitoring, security scanning), strong feature set in the free tier, good for enterprise use.
- Cons: Can be resource-intensive, more complex than Gitea or Codeberg.
- Best For: DevOps-focused teams, projects requiring a full CI/CD pipeline, enterprise environments.
-
Gitea (Self-Hosted):
- Pros: Lightweight, easy to install and manage, good privacy, full control over your data.
- Cons: Requires server administration skills, you re responsible for backups and security.
- Best For: Developers and organizations wanting complete control over their Git hosting, privacy-focused individuals.
-
SourceHut:
- Pros: Privacy-focused, minimalist interface, emphasizes email-based workflows.
- Cons: Steeper learning curve (uses email patching workflows), not as feature-rich as GitHub or GitLab, no web editor.
- Best For: Experienced developers comfortable with command-line tools and email-based development workflows.
-
Bitbucket:
- Pros: Free for small teams (up to 5 users), tight integration with Atlassian tools (Jira, Confluence).
- Cons: Primarily focused on private repositories, less emphasis on FOSS.
- Best For: Teams already using Atlassian products, private development.
-
Framagit:
- Pros: Another GitLab instance operated by a non-profit, open to the public. Privacy and open-source focused
- Cons: May be less performant than Codeberg or Gitea
Pricing
-
Free: Codeberg is free to use for public and private repositories.
-
Donations Encouraged: Users are encouraged to donate to support the platform s operations. There are options to donate via various methods on their website.
Customer Care
-
Community Support: Primarily relies on community-based support.
-
Forum/Issue Tracker: Use the Codeberg issue tracker for bug reports, feature requests, and general support questions.
-
Documentation: Limited official documentation compared to commercial platforms. The Gitea documentation is often helpful as Codeberg is based on Gitea.
-
No Guaranteed SLAs: As a non-profit, there are no guaranteed service level agreements (SLAs).
